Attleborough is a thriving market town located between Norwich and Thetford in the district of Breckland. The town has a fantastic variety of shops and supermarkets, a primary and secondary school, a sports hall, doctors' surgeries, dentists, opticians, restaurants and takeaways. There is also a weekly market held on Thursdays. The town also benefits from excellent road links to London being close to the A11 and having a train station on the main line between Norwich and Cambridge.

To comply with HMRC's regulations on Anti-Money Laundering (AML), Whittley Parish are legally required to conduct AML checks on every purchaser(s) once a sale is agreed. We use a government-approved electronic identity verification service from Landmark to ensure compliance, accuracy, and security. This is approved by the Government as part of the Digital Identity and Attributes Trust Framework (DIATF).  

The cost of anti-money laundering (AML) checks is £50 + VAT (£60 inc VAT) per purchase, payable in advance after an offer has been accepted. This fee to Whittley Parish is mandatory to comply with HMRC regulations and must be paid before a memorandum of sale can be issued. Please note that the fee is non-refundable.
